Herb Patch Locations There are four spots that Jagex calls full patches; these contain an herb patch, flower patch, two allotment patches (for fruits and vegetables) and a compost bin. In addition, there is a fifth herb patch that you can unlock by completing the quest My Arms Big Adventure. Experienced herb farmers know these places well, but if youre new to the skill I figured you could use a bit of an introduction. J This patch is located a couple of clicks north of the Catherby bank; it is most easily accessed by casting Camelot Teleport and running east. If you are on the Lunar Magicks spellbook, its Catherby Teleport spell is even faster. The Catherby patch is the most popular of the four patches, because it is close to a teleport, a bank and a farming store. Some people call this the Falador patch; in fact, its between the two towns, but closer to Draynor. The fastest way to get to it is to use an amulet of glory to teleport to Draynor, then run northwest to the road that leads towards Port Sarim. Go west past the wall that separates Port Sarim from Draynor, and youll see a cabbage patch to the north, and a stile you can step on to cross into it. Run north through the cabbages to the patch. If coming from Falador, take the path from near the east bank south out of town, then turn east and continue until you get to the patch. During the quest My Arms Big Adventure, youll be introduced to a gardening troll named My Arm, and will help him make an herb patch; hell then agree to watch another herb patch that you can use, and ensure it never gets diseased. The benefits of this are quite obvious: 25% more production per run, and no need to worry about disease! The drawback is that getting to the patch is a bit of a hassle. The only practical way of getting there requires the Trollheim Teleport spell, which also has its own quest requirement: Eadgers Ruse. So you really need to complete both if you want to use this patch regularly. To get to the patch, cast Trollheim Teleport; you arrive at the top of Trollheim. Run down off the mountain, heading towards the west; there are numerous Agility shortcuts you can use to aid you (level 43 to 47 required). Go south, around a U-bend and then north, towards the path that curves west to the entrance to the troll stronghold (Figure 187).
Once in the stronghold, run south, then open the door to your west, go through it and run north. Youll find a troll ladder going up; climb it and youre on the roof of the stronghold. Head north and youll find the patch near My Arms. Be warned that you will go past aggressive trolls in getting to the patch. High-level players can just absorb the damage, but lower-level players may wish to ensure they have enough Prayer points to slap on Protection from Melee for a short time. Do not wear armor for thisits not necessary and will slow you down.
